Coding and software development job market insights report: Trends and statistics for the UK sector [January 26]

Based on current data taken from Adzuna, one of the UK's largest job search engines, we've identified the clear trends and figures that define the state of the coding and software development sector job market today. This report was last updated on 28 January 2026.

Coding and software development salaries are 56.8% above the national average

  • Despite an incline at the very beginning of 2026, mean salaries for data roles consistently exceed the national average
  • The mean salary for data roles October 2025 to January 2026 inclusively is £66,566 which represents a 5.2% YoY increase.  

Demand for coding professionals remains high compared to the national average

  • The total number of unique postings for coding and software development job roles on the Adzuna website, October 2025 to January 2026: 40,490.
  • The number of new postings for coding job roles on the Adzuna website, October 2025 to January 2026: 32,273 
  • The dip in unique and new postings at the end of 2025 is due to seasonal trends - both increase as expected further into January, with a 8.2% YoY increase for new postings. 

Communications and finance industries among the top hiring coding professionals

The demand for coding and software development professionals is growing - the need goes beyond just IT and tech, spanning numerous industries such as science, manufacturing, defence, and the arts. 

 

Top benefits for coding and software development roles include private healthcare and flexible working

The data above is calculated from 16,369 (40.4%) unique coding job role postings.

16,518 (40.8%) unique postings offered at least one benefit.

Over half of coding roles are flexible or remote

  • 38.36% of coding and software development job roles were listed on Adzuna as hybrid or flexible roles.
  • 44.93% required on-site work.
  • 16.71% were fully remote.

The South East and North West sees most demand for coding roles

London leads data job demand with 14,000 job openings on Adzuna, reflecting its status as a major business hub. The South East follows with 4,662 unique postings, and the North West with 3377 for the period October 2025 to January 2026. 

Where does this data come from?

To create this report, we've partnered with Adzuna, one of the UK's biggest job search engine platforms and an extremely comprehensive source of job market data.

Based on millions of job postings, the Adzuna Intelligence database gives us a better understanding of job or specific role demand in the coding and software development sector.

It also helps us identify trends related to salary, geographic location within the UK, the kinds of benefits that are being offered to coding and software development professionals, and much more.
